WebAs a major part of the April 2015 pension rules changes, it became possible to take your entire pension fund in one go as cash for you to spend as you wish. You can do this from the age of 55 (rising to 57 in 2028). However, there are considerable tax implications to consider before going for this option. To do this, you can close you pension ... Web11 de abr. de 2024 · Commercial property can be bought and held as an investment within a Self-Invested Pension Plan (SIPP) or a Small Self-Administered Scheme (SSAS). Although there are some differences between them, the general idea is the same: invest in property to earn a return on your pension fund. You can use your pension fund to invest in …
